FRENCH APPLE COBBLER 
FILLING:

5 c. peeled and sliced tart apples
3/4 c. sugar
2 tbsp. all-purpose flour
1/2 tsp. cinnamon
1/4 tsp. salt
1/4 c. water
1 tsp. vanilla
2 tbsp. butter

BATTER:

1/2 c. sifted flour
1/2 c. sugar
1/2 tsp. baking powder
1/4 tsp. salt
2 tbsp. butter
1 slightly beaten egg

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Make filling in medium bowl. Combine apples, sugar, flour, cinnamon, salt, vanilla and water. Turn into 9 x 9 x 1 3/4 inch baking pan. Dot apples with butter.

Make batter in bowl. Combine all batter ingredients and beat with wooden spoon until smooth. Drop batter in 9 portions on apples, spacing evenly. Batter will spread during baking. Bake 35-40 minutes or until apples are fork tender and crust is golden brown. Serve warm with cream. Makes 6-8 servings.

For larger pan, double the recipe.
